#40f442 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#40f442 is composed of 25.1% red, 95.7%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 73%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 120.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 60.4%. #40f442 color hex could be obtained by blending #80ff84 with #00e900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#40f442 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#40f442 has RGB values of R:64, G:244,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4256834.

Shades and Tints of #40f442
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d01 is the darkest color, while #f9f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#40f442
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959f96 is the less saturated color, while #38fc3a is the most saturated one.
